#8ebffe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8ebffe is composed of 55.7% red, 74.9%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.1% cyan, 24.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 213.8 degrees, a saturation of 98.2% and a lightness of 77.6%. #8ebffe color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1d7ffd. Closest websafe color is: #99ccff.

#8ebffe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8ebffe has RGB values of R:142, G:191,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0.25,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 9355262.

Hex triplet 8ebffe #8ebffe
RGB Decimal 142, 191, 254 rgb(142,191,254)
RGB Percent 55.7, 74.9, 99.6 rgb(55.7%,74.9%,99.6%)
CMYK 44, 25, 0, 0
HSL 213.8°, 98.2, 77.6 hsl(213.8,98.2%,77.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 213.8°, 44.1, 99.6
Web Safe 99ccff #99ccff
CIE-LAB 76.171, -0.027, -36.092
XYZ 47.672, 50.166, 100.932
xyY 0.24, 0.252, 50.166
CIE-LCH 76.171, 36.092, 269.957
CIE-LUV 76.171, -24.71, -58.411
Hunter-Lab 70.828, -3.808, -34.91
Binary 10001110, 10111111, 11111110

Shades and Tints of #8ebffe

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000204 is the darkest color, while #eff6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#8ebffe

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c3c6c9 is the less saturated color, while #8ebffe is the most saturated one.
